FRIENDLY


Meaning of FRIENDLY in English

[friend.ly] adj friend.li.er ; -est (bef. 12c) 1: of, relating to, or befitting a friend: as a: showing kindly interest and goodwill b: not hostile "a ~ merger offer"; also: involving or coming from actions of one's own forces "~ fire" c: cheerful, comforting "the ~ glow of the fire"

2: serving a beneficial or helpful purpose

3: easy to use or understand "~ computer software" syn see amicable -- friend.li.ly adv -- friend.li.ness n

[2]friendly adv (bef. 12c): in a friendly manner: amicably [3]friendly n, pl friendlies (1861) 1: one that is friendly; esp: a native who is friendly to settlers or invaders

2. Brit: a match between sports teams and esp. international teams that has no connection with league or championship play
